Hours: 45 hours per week, Monday to Friday, Saturday morning rota, as required

Responsibilities:

  • The Valeter/Driver's job is first and foremost to valet vehicles following repair in our bodyshop.
  • You will also be required to support our team of Drivers, to collect customers' vehicles and deliver them to the Bodyshop for repair.
  • Customers trust us, so you will always be professional, providing a first-class service every time.
  • It is also important that you drive vehicles in a safe and lawful manner, considering weather and traffic conditions.
  • You need to collect, valet and deliver vehicles, ensure all necessary paperwork is completed, collect payments and receipts, report accidents/incidents and comply fully with health and safety legislation.

How to prepare for a job interview at ZIGUP plc

Know Your Stuff

Before the interview, brush up on your knowledge of vehicle valeting and driving regulations. Familiarise yourself with the specific responsibilities mentioned in the job description, like handling paperwork and ensuring safety compliance. This will show that you're serious about the role and ready to hit the ground running.

Showcase Your Professionalism

Since this role involves interacting with customers, it's crucial to demonstrate your professionalism during the interview. Dress smartly, maintain good eye contact, and be polite. Share examples from your past experiences where you provided excellent customer service or handled challenging situations effectively.

Be Ready for Practical Questions

Expect questions that assess your practical skills, such as how you would handle a specific situation while valeting or driving. Prepare by thinking through scenarios you might face on the job, like dealing with difficult weather conditions or managing tight schedules. This will help you articulate your problem-solving abilities.

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team dynamics, training opportunities, or the company’s future plans. This shows your genuine interest in the position and helps you determine if it’s the right fit for you. Plus, it gives you a chance to engage with the interviewer on a deeper level.
